Transaction 66ccaef9680d48aab676e9f91df15ff7d3f50bd75f1a3b375f3c13fa302c8622

2 Input
2 Outputs
  • 66ccaef9680d48aab676e9f91df15ff7d3f50bd75f1a3b375f3c13fa302c8622:0
  • value  170768
    address  3Ggs5SKi3PzfbwQbBCgUykhudZQ8HZHbv9
  • 66ccaef9680d48aab676e9f91df15ff7d3f50bd75f1a3b375f3c13fa302c8622:1
  • value  862665
    address  32daZ4KwSCgkHNadyhZUEep7X6rmGau7sQ